The 0.01% funding rate observed in EDEN derivatives represents a critical indicator of bullish sentiment within the platform's trading ecosystem. When positive funding rates remain above zero percent, they signal that long position holders are willing to pay to maintain their exposure, reflecting underlying optimism about price direction. At this specific rate level, the measured leverage among long positions suggests traders are exercising restraint rather than deploying aggressive, overleveraged bets.

This moderate rate structure differs significantly from the extreme scenarios sometimes observed across crypto derivatives platforms. Rather than indicating frothy market conditions typical of funding rates exceeding 0.1%, the 0.01% positioning in EDEN derivatives demonstrates a balanced approach where bulls maintain conviction without excessive risk accumulation. This measured sentiment becomes particularly meaningful when analyzing cross-platform dynamics, as funding rate variations reveal how market participants structure their leverage preferences across different venues.

The implication extends beyond simple price speculation. Positive funding rates at these conservative levels suggest that long-position traders on EDEN derivatives view price appreciation as achievable through sustainable positions. This stands in contrast to environments where skyrocketing funding rates indicate overleveraged speculation. Such disciplined leverage behavior among long positions often precedes more stable price movements, as it reflects institutional and sophisticated retail participation rather than reckless speculation driven by fear of missing out.

What is the funding rate in the crypto derivatives market and how does it reflect market sentiment and leveraged positions?

Funding rates represent periodic payments between long and short position holders, typically settled every 8 hours. Higher rates indicate bullish sentiment with excess longs, while lower or negative rates suggest bearish sentiment. These rates directly impact leveraged traders by increasing holding costs during bull runs, often triggering deleveraging events.

How do large-scale liquidation events shown in liquidation data affect market prices?

Large-scale liquidation events typically trigger sharp price declines and increased market volatility. These cascading liquidations can create downward spirals, pushing prices lower and forcing more positions to close at unfavorable levels, amplifying market uncertainty and systemic risk.

How to develop risk management strategies using funding rates, open interest, and liquidation data?

Monitor funding rates to gauge market sentiment and adjust leverage accordingly. Track open interest changes to identify trend reversals. Analyze liquidation data to set stop-loss levels below liquidation clusters. Diversify positions across multiple assets and timeframes to reduce concentrated risk exposure.
